Transaction 9504213425a1a7b915d91aedc95753435df122d491c6966c1619cdd966929369

1 Input
2 Outputs
  • 9504213425a1a7b915d91aedc95753435df122d491c6966c1619cdd966929369:0
  • value  420000
    address  12JN31bPjrSVqe3JwUEDFc37KrPCyrzp8L
  • 9504213425a1a7b915d91aedc95753435df122d491c6966c1619cdd966929369:1
  • value  959882
    address  1Cs6NQmAeT18Jx8fSZoWf889JvXm7xSGgW